Top Local Business In Labhari | Reviews & Ratings | vimarsana.com

Local business in labhari in India - 243635 / Local-business near Labhari near Labhari

Local business in labhari in India - 243635 / Local-business near Labhari near Labhari

Local business in labhari in India - 243635 / Local-business near Labhari near Labhari

Local business in labhari in India - 243635 / Local-business near Labhari near Labhari